Without another genuine star, I’m not sure this team this team’s current core has more potential than the Joe Johnson or Paul Millsap Hawks. Zacc would need to explode. We probably top out at a 47-52 win team that never truly contends.

At least trading for Giannis is interesting and makes the franchise relevant for a few seasons.
Sure the risk is turning it into a 10 year mistake if we give up too much, but is the downside really that much worse than just being what we’ve always been.

Giannis is a 2x MVP and still a finalist every year. His length is genuinely disruptive on defence. He would be an amazing lob threat for Trae. They’d be a great pairing. He will be a 7x first team all nba player. We haven’t had a first teamer or mvp candidate since 1986. Sure he’s not young, but he’s still playing at an elite level and he keeps himself in great shape, and is highly motivated. There’s enough evidence that Trae is not that guy, but with someone like Giannis he could maybe have Suns Nash type production.

Speaking purely as a fan, I’d rather us at least try then just go through the motions for another 40 years in the hope that one day we draft a generational talent (and hope we don’t trade them on draft night).

Case against Giannis........

If GA and Lillard couldn't make it work, then how could Young and GA make it work?

GA and Lillard are both too ball dominate and the chemistry just wasn't there. Jru Holiday was a defensive PG who plays well off ball and it still allowed GA to set up the offense and that is why Jru and GA won a chip together.

For Trae and GA, which of the two would be willing to play, off ball so the other guy can get into rhythm?

Bucks hoping to pitch Giannis Antetokounmpo on using 2025-26 as retooling year for team

A significant aspect of the Bucks’ pitch, then, is selling Giannis Antetokounmpo on the idea of a so-called gap year that enables them to retool the team while allowing him to maintain his one-team affiliation after 12 seasons in Milwaukee. The very forgiving East landscape certainly enhances the notion that it wouldn’t take years (with an s) to return to contention. The Bucks are also hoping that the presence of Doc Rivers as coach can provide some sort of boost.

 

– via Marc Stein @ marcstein.substack.com
